MoVernie Top #3 Memory of 2015 – SW Virginia: Birthplace of Country Music & The Crooked Road

Year of 2015

A lot of peeps know that I like to listen to hip-hop, R&B and EDM but as most peeps also know that I am open minded and always willing to learn and experience new things that are out of my normal boundaries. When I was invited on a media trip to SW Virginia, covering the birthplace of Country Music, I decided to be on the MOVE to check out what this region has to offer. Before this media trip, every time I think of country music, I always think of Nashville, but Nashville is not the birthplace of country music. It was a group of talented singers and bands who made a visit to Bristol, Virginia in 1927 and recorded a famous sessions recording, paving the way for the evolution of the country music. As we toured along “The Crooked Road”, I got to visit various historic venues and museums and got a chance to know the culture and the traditions country music had brought to the region of this area. The Appalachians, the mountain tops and beautiful landscapes created a unique experience of my visit. Did you know Bristol is also famous for NASCAR? The Bristol Speedway can sits over 100,000 people at the race. I hope to check that out in the near future. Also, SW Virginia is also famous for making Moonshine, a high-proofed distilled spirits that was originally an illegal product has now been legalized 5 years ago.

MoVernie Top #12 Memory of 2015 – The Sher Club: Private Party with Raptors GM Masai Ujiri

Year of 2015

Drake, our Raptors Global Ambassador had quietly opened an exclusive sports club in Toronto’s Air Canada Centre. It’s called the “Sher Club,” in honour of his grandparents Rueben & Evelyn Sher. The Sher Club has been under the radar a bit as it’s a members-only club at the ACC. The club itself was a joint venture between Drake, MLSE, the ACC and high-end architectural designer Ferris Rafauli.

Last month, I was invited to attend a very Exclusive VIP Private Party at this intimate 4,000 sq. ft. space. Raptors GM Masai Ujiri invited 30 Raptors Season Ticket Holders and their plus ones to check out the Sher Club. What makes this club special is the fact that it’s members only. This means in most occasions, you have to be a member in order to have access to this Sher Club. The only other times you can access this establishment is by invite-only to a private event.
